PROGRAM SUMMARY
This NSTA award posthumously recognizes long-standing members of NSTA for significant life-long service to NSTA and
contributions to science education.
ELIGIBILITY
This award is open to long-standing members of NSTA (minimum 15 years) who have been deceased for no more than
10 years. An individual may be nominated within ten (10) years after their death; however, there may be variances to
these criteria. The NSTA Awards and Recognitions Committee should be consulted in writing prior to recommending an
individual more than (10) ten years after their death.
AWARD
One or more individuals may be selected by the NSTA Awards and Recognitions Committee to be honored at the annual
Awards Banquet during the NSTA National Conference. A plaque will be presented to the family of the honoree. NSTA
will provide 2 nights lodging, and up to $500 towards travel expenses for a family member to attend the NSTA National
Conference. A permanent Legacy Award display, located at the NSTA headquarters, will include the honoree’s name.
